Types of Research 'pure research'. This approach is undertaken in order to contribute to abstract, theoretical understanding; 'instrumentalist research'. An alternative motivation is to contribute to understanding in order to be able to more effectively act or to 'design interventions' into the environment. Two sub-categories of instrumentalist research need to be distinguished: 'applied research'. This commences with a technology (an artefact, a technique, or both) and uses it in an experimental fashion to intervene into personal, organisational or social processes; and 'problem-oriented research'. This begins with a problem. It experiments with existing technologies and/or prototypes new ones, in an effort to devise a solution (e.g.Clarke, 2000). Dr J Whatley, September

Qualitative Research Dr J Whatley, September Qualitative research focuses on text rather than numbers Text is what people say, written and verbal Enables researchers to explain and understand social and cultural phenomena
